Seen the film this morning. I'll try to review without any major spoilers.

The movie looks amazing - several new jaw-dropping Terminator models are on display and Christian Bale is (as you'd expect) great as the fifth (?) person to play John Connor so far. There's less of the time-twisting predestination paradox malarkey than usual (we hear Sarah on a tape saying "a person could go crazy thinking about all this" ). Forget the cancelled TV series with the unfeasibly long title - "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les" - that doesn't appear to fit into this timeline at all.

<<MINOR SPOILER ALERT>>

On the downside, the plot is perhaps a little thin and not as urgent and nailbiting as in the original "Terminator" movie and in "T2: Judgement Day". The feeling I had was that this might support the view that the intention is to make a "Terminator: Salvation" trilogy.


<<MINOR SPOILER OVER>>

In summary, IMHO - whilst not quite up to the standard of those first two movies - this is a better sequel than either "T3: Rise of the Vacuum Cleaners" or the cancelled TV show.
